Today’s topic is about what I consider to be the worst misconception people have about Hera. And I think it is the modern preoccupation with Hera being the “jealous” wife who torments every child of Zeus other than those by her. This is a perception that, in my opinion, really was thrust into prominence by the television series Hercules: The Legendary Journeys (starring Kevin Sorbo, who is most known these days as a Christian apologist in the same vein as Kirk Cameron).
This portrayal was not found in movies dating from the 1960’s such as Jason and the Argonauts where Hera was portrayed in a far more sympathetic way. However, despite Hera being shown in the movie from 1963 as a more rounded character, the portrayal popularized by the television series, is the one more people know about.
When dealing with Hera, it is the issue of her focus on a wide variety of mankind’s problems that is ignored. And, personally, I despise how two-dimensionally people view her.
